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Removal

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repair costs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s that you need Residential Water Remov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ors that linger in your home or condo may be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ore the smell it could be a sign of mold growth or bacterial contamination.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Residential Water Removal Cost in Stafford, TX

The cost of Residential Water Removal in Stafford, TX can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

ServiceTypical Price RangeWhat Affects Cost
Water removal and extraction$500 – $2,500Severity of damage, size of affected area
Drying and monitoring$1,000 – $5,000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Restoration and reconstruction$2,000 – $10,000Severity of damage, type of materials needed
Mold remediation$1,500 – $6,000Severity of mold growth, size of affected area
Disinfection and deodorization$500 – $2,000Severity of damage, size of affected area
More services (e.g. Carpet cleaning, upholstery cleaning)$100 – $1,000Severity of damage, size of affected area

Q: How do I prevent water damage in my home?

A: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Our team recommends checking your home’s plumbing and roof regularly, as well as inspecting your gutters and downspouts for any signs of damage. We also recommend installing flood sensors and monitoring systems so you can detect any issues before they become major problems.
